By Ian O. Angell
Offers a complete advent to special effects utilizing uncomplicated at the IBM laptop. presents in-depth insurance of pixel block and personality snap shots, games or low-resolution portraits, the development of knowledge graphs, - and third-dimensional snap shots, the set-up of advanced gadgets, hidden line and floor algorithms, and point of view and stereoscopic perspectives. historical past arithmetic resembling coordinate geometry and matrix manipulation are defined intimately, and software segments and vast illustrations are supplied.
Read or Download Advanced Graphics with the IBM Personal Computer PDF
Best nonfiction_13 books
This ebook attracts on a big variety of interdisciplinary literature discussing advanced adaptive structures - together with scholarship from economics, political technological know-how, evolutionary biology, cognitive technology, and faith - to use normal complexity tenets to the associations, conceptual framework, and theoretical justifications of the copyright approach, either within the usa and across the world.
A controversy for the lifestyles of a psychological see observed which within the final 250 years has affected quite a lot of human attitudes and actions. while the see observed tilts to severe optimism or pessimism, every kind of attitudes, usually visible as unconnected, stream too. quite a few highbrow actions and events are partially less than the sway of the seesaw, yet its robust impression is never spotted.
This thesis reviews the newest advancements within the direct amination of varied C−H bonds utilizing an H−Zn exchange/electrophilic amination method. McDonald and colleagues show this method of be a speedy and robust technique for having access to quite a few functionalized amines. the cloth defined during this ebook indicates how McDonald completed C−H zincation utilizing robust, non-nucleophilic zinc bases and next electrophilic amination of the corresponding zinc carbanions with copper as a catalyst and O-benzoylhydroxylamines because the electrophilic nitrogen resource.
- Bioactive Compounds in Agricultural Soils
- Human Rights, Migration, and Social Conflict: Toward a Decolonized Global Justice
- Edible food packaging: materials and processing technologies
- 365 Earrings You Can Make - A BeadStyle Magazine Special Issue 2008
Extra info for Advanced Graphics with the IBM Personal Computer
Remember that the graphics frame may be in MODE% = 1 or MODE%= 2. Furthermore the aspect ratio of the monitor must be taken into account (see chapter 1): the aspect value is stored in the variable ASPECT. 1 -- in this case 1; the equivalent mode 2 value of ASPECT is then calculated by the program if necessary. Make sure you know if your monitor or television set has ASPECT = 1 or 5/6 in mode 1. For simplicity, this area will initially have its edges parallel to the x andy axes of Cartesian space.
In order to understand how WINDOW works, it is best to start by resorting to the original interpretation of the SCREEN, imagining it as a graphics frame consisting of a mode-dependent rectangular matrix of pixels. These pixels are stacked in NXPIX% (say) vertical columns and NYPIX% (say) horizontal rows. If MODE%= 1 (medium-resolution) then NXPIX% = 320, and if MODE%= 2 (high-resolution) NXPIX% = 640: NYPIX% = 200 in both modes. Individuals from the set of NXPIX% by NYPIX% pixels can be uniquely identified by a bracketed pair of integers- sometimes called a pixel vector (I, J), where 0 ~I~ NXPIX%-1 and 0 ~ J ~ NYPIX%-1.
Each number is treated as four colours (4 sets of two bits, from left to right) in mode 1, or 2 colours in mode 2 (8 sets of 1-bit numbers, also from left to right). A tile is created by stacking these n groups of colours one below the other. This process can be imagined to start at the top left hand corner of the screen, moving horizontally in steps of 4 (mode 1) or 8 (mode 2) and vertically in steps of n until the whole screen is filled. In this way each pixel on the screen has its colour uniquely defined by a tile.
Advanced Graphics with the IBM Personal Computer by Ian O. Angell